    The overall mission of CSE advising is...

  • To provide the most relevant and complete information possible to prospective and current students, serving as a resource that guides students toward finding solutions
  • To foster an atmosphere within the Department where all students feel welcome, heard, and responded to
  • To continually review and update the services that we provide, making sure that students are able to obtain an excellent undergraduate educational experience


Drop-In Hours

    Drop-in hours are for quick questions (5-10 minutes). Students who wish to see an advisor during drop-in hours should check in at the CSE reception desk in the Paul G. Allen Center for CSE. Below is a current schedule of available drop-in hours.

Make an Appointment

    CSE departmental advisors are happy to meet with prospective students from high schools, community colleges, other universities, and current UW students. Prospective students should attend an information session first, before scheduling an individual appointment. Information sessions provide details about departmental admissions process, degree planning, and opportunities for students. There is no need to RSVP, just attend the one that will fit with your schedule. These are generally small groups of students, and there is always time to ask individual questions.
